The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The fairness of online casino games hinges on the use of Random Number Generators (RNGs). These sophisticated algorithms ensure that each outcome – whether a spin of a roulette wheel or the deal of a card – is completely random and unbiased. Reputable online casinos subject their RNGs to rigorous testing by independent auditing agencies, such as eCOGRA, to verify their fairness and integrity. These audits provide players with confidence that the games are not rigged and that they have a genuine chance of winning. Transparent reporting of the RNG testing results is a strong indicator of a casino’s commitment to fairness and responsible gaming. Without a properly functioning and regularly audited RNG, the entire system is compromised.
| Game Type | Typical House Edge |
|---|---|
|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) | 0.5% – 1% |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% |
| Roulette (American) | 5.26% |
| Baccarat | 1.06% (Banker Bet) |
The table above provides a general overview of the typical house edge associated with popular casino games. Understanding these percentages can help players make informed decisions about which games offer the best odds of winning. It's important to remember that house edge is a statistical average, and individual results can vary significantly.

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, are the cornerstone of most casino bonuses. They represent the number of times you must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ount) before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. Lower wagering requirements are generally more favorable, as they allow you to access your winnings more easily. It’s also essential to check which games contribute towards the wagering requirements, as some games may have a lower contribution percentage than others. Failing to meet the wagering requirements will result in the forfeiture of the bonus and any associated winnings.

Ensuring Secure Transactions and Data Protection
Security is paramount when engaging in online gambling. Reputable casinos employ advanced encryption technologies,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ption, to protect your personal and financial information. This ensures that all data transmitted between your device and the casino server is securely encrypted and unreadable to unauthorized parties. Furthermore, casinos should adhere to stringent data protection policies, complying with relevant regulations such as G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ation). Checking for certifications from recognized security organizations, such as those offering PCI DSS compliance (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ard), can provide additional reassurance. Responsible casinos also implement fraud prevention measures to detect and prevent fraudulent activities.
